Employee Resigned and Didn't Work During Notice Period: Is He Still Eligible for a Bonus?

Muniraju N
Hi All,

One of our employees had resigned from the job, and we stopped him from coming to the office. We paid him 2 months' salary as the notice period.

I have a question regarding his eligibility for the statutory bonus, as there was no contribution from his service to the company during those 2 months.

Nagarkar Vinayak L
Dear fellow,

First of all, his eligibility for a bonus under the Act has to be checked. Assuming that he is eligible, in my view, no bonus is payable on the notice period. Statutory bonus is payable on wages earned for having worked by attending duties. The notice pay is a contractual obligation and cannot be equated with days worked.
